For an RBL to work it has to be dynamic, change has to happen as the
spamming is taking place in order to block the spam. You cannot delay the
blocking or the spam gets thru before the block happens. The level is not
one of being blocked more widely but instead one of how long it takes to
get off the list. If you get on the problem right away you get off the list
right away, if you wait a long time then it takes longer to get off the
list. That's what the spam ratio does. The more complaints the worse the
ratio and the longer it takes for the ratio to return to an acceptable
level.
